Cheapest 0800 Numbers with Mobile Re-Divert

Options
Looking to set up an 0800 number that routinely diverts to my BT landline. However there will be occasions when I will want to re-divert calls from the 0800 number to my mobile. Did a bit of research and this is what I have come up with so far.

The cheapest way to do this is to divert the landline to the mobile and NOT divert the 0800 directly to the mobile.

0800 numbers best deal
less than 750 minutes per month use Call08 Bronze service £0 setup, £4.95 pcm, 2p/min, 500 free
750 or more minutes per month use Call08 Silver service £0 setup, £9.95 pcm 2p/min, 1500 free

The cheapest way to divert my BT landline to my mobile will be to:
  • Sign up for the Friends and Family Mobile which is free if you sign a 12 month contract otherwise £1.50 a month. Calls cost 7p/min
  • Sign up for the Call Diversion Calling Feature at £2.50 a month
Can anyone add anything to this? If I was certain my BT line would allow me to call divert to a mobile via an override provider then this may reduce cost further but not sure about this.

    Calls which you divert using BT's Call Diversion calling feature will be routed via your CPS calls provider (if you have one) but BT does not allow any prefixes (like 18185) in the 'divert to' string.

    Primus used to offer a CPS package (Penny Mobile 2) which allowed calls to mobiles (i.e. including such diverts) for a flat rate of 20p for up to 20 minutes and, until their call centre started denying all knowledge of the package, it was a recommendation of mine. I'm still on it but, unfortunately, I haven't heard of anyone successfully signing up for Penny Mobile 2 for some months now.
